The village of Scorton is situated in the Forest of Bowland, Lancashire and is popular with day visitors, walkers and cyclists. The village is set on the banks of the River Wye and is particularly fortunate with its location, being only a short way from the A6 and yet on the edge of the Forest of Bowland AONB.
